ABC Business Summary

ABC Taiwan Electronics Corp. (3236.TWO) is a specialized manufacturer of passive electronic components, generating revenue through the high-volume production and global distribution of inductive devices and thermal management solutions. The company’s business model is centered on three core segments: Inductive Components, which includes SMD chip inductors, power supply inductors, and transformers; Heat Management Solutions, featuring proprietary micro-porous ceramic (MPC) heat sinks; and Precision Metal Components. These products serve as critical infrastructure for noise filtering, power conversion, and heat dissipation in the automotive, industrial automation, telecommunications, and consumer electronics end-markets. In the global competitive landscape, ABC Taiwan Electronics contends with major industry players including Murata Manufacturing, TDK Corporation, Taiyo Yuden, and Chilisin Electronics (Yageo). The company distinguishes itself through a strategic focus on high-reliability automotive and industrial applications, leveraging its advanced R&D and customization capabilities to maintain a premium position relative to commodity-scale manufacturers. Founded in 1979, the company is led by Chairman and CEO Joseph Hsu (Mingen Hsu), an industry veteran who previously served as a divisional manager at TDK Taiwan. The executive leadership team includes President Francis Fan, who oversees the company’s global manufacturing operations and its international subsidiaries in China and the United States. ABC’s strategic positioning is reinforced by its board of directors, which includes Dan-Wei Kuo, the President of Bourns Electronics (Taiwan), representing the long-standing partnership and investment from the global electronics leader Bourns, Inc. Other notable board members include Louis Chen, a professor and expert in digital governance. As of 2026, ABC Taiwan Electronics remains a publicly traded entity on the Taipei Exchange, with a leadership team focused on capitalizing on structural demand for AI-related semiconductor components and green energy infrastructure, supported by a robust board of 11 members and a strategic emphasis on ESG-driven technological innovation.
